Do you constantly feel overwhelmed with busyness or like your energy is being pulled in a hundred different directions? In this episode I am talking with Greg McKeown, he is the author of the book, Essentialism. Today Greg shares a counter-culture solution for overcoming the constant pursuit of more that this world is always offering us. If done properly, it will lead to greater results and fulfillment in your life and work. Get ready to learn how to become an essentialist!

Takeaways

Essentialism is about focusing on what truly matters.
The undisciplined pursuit of more leads to burnout.
Creating space to explore what's essential is crucial.
Eliminating non-essential tasks can lead to greater productivity.
Execution should be made as effortless as possible.
Systems can help achieve residual results in business.
Asking 'What's important now?' can guide decision-making.
Prioritization is key to effective time management.
The endowment effect can hinder the ability to eliminate non-essentials.
Essentialism is relevant now more than ever due to increased distractions.
